Learnlabs - Social Learning & Labs
in Stockholm, SwedenCategory: Local business
0 views
0 shares
0 comments

Created/changed by:
System
Address details
St:Eriksgatan 63, 100 28 Stockholm, Sweden Print route »Coordinates
N59° 20' 12.05388" E18° 2' 3.10898" (59.336681632408, 18.034196938851)